How much do homes sell for in St Martinvlle, LA?
The average home price is currently $180,014.
In St Martinvlle, LA, how many homes are available?
There are currently 8 active home listings available in St Martinvlle.
What’s the average rental cost in St Martinvlle, LA?
The average rental price in St Martinvlle is $1,254.
What is the most expensive home in St Martinvlle?
The most expensive home sold in St Martinvlle had a price of $395,056.
What is currently the cheapest priced home in St Martinvlle, LA?
The cheapest home for sale in St Martinvlle is priced at $59,174.
Living in St Martinvlle, LA
St. Martinville, LA is a picturesque city with a rich cultural heritage and a friendly community atmosphere. Known for its beautiful scenic spots and outdoor activities along the Bayou Teche, it combines history with modern lifestyle conveniences. Residents enjoy a relaxed pace of life with access to local schools, parks, and a vibrant downtown.

Home Value Estimator For St Martinvlle, LA
There are currently 21 real estate properties
in St Martinvlle, LA,
with a median automated valuation model (AVM) price
of $154,005.00. What is an AVM? It is
a smart computer program that analyzes and predicts the approximate value of a home,
property or land in St Martinvlle, LA, based on current market
trends, comparable real
estate sales nearby, historical data and, of course, property features, among other
variables. These automated home estimates are often very helpful, providing buyers
and
sellers with a better idea of a home’s value ahead of the negotiation process. For
